Pepperoni Potato Wedges

Postby copkid » Thu Feb 07, 2008 10:24 am

This was pretty simple. I just baked some potatoes until almost done, with a nice hint of firmness. I cut into wedges, sprinkled with garlic powder, red pepper, salt and paprika. Topped with pepperoni slices, cheddar and Mozz. cheeses. Baked until golden brown and served with sour cream and fresh parsley!

One more hint; let the baked taters cool til at least lukewarm, and they won't fall apart on you when you cut them into wedges. I didn't wait, and I had many nice chunks, but not all the wedges I wanted! (hey, we were hungry! :oops: )
